    Hello everyone,

    Newbie question: I've decided on SugarCRM Community Edition for my ecommerce CRM needs, that was a no-brainer, and I'm using this decision to help narrow down the choices from among all the open source CMS apps out there. There are hundreds of them.

    I want to choose one for my small business that is scalable and can be integrated with SugarCRM, and the best ones seem to be PHP-based anyway. So which PHP CMS's can be most easily integrated with Sugar as well as other PHP apps such as a project management app like eGroupWare or Mantis?

    Is this kind of integration best done with thru a PHP framework? If so, which PHP framework is the most Sugar-friendly? and Mac-friendly? I run Mac OS X so it needs to be Mac-compatible as well.

    Hi Jeff

    SouthwestCRM has integrated SugarCRM and Joomla! The component syncs SugarCRM Accounts and Contacts (and custom fields) with fields in Joomla. If you use a free Joomla component called Community Builder you can create an unlimited number of fields in your CMS system which sync with fields in SugarCRM.

    Contacts you create in Sugar will be created in Joomla. And vise versa.

    You can control access to your CMS system from within Sugar and if you delete a contact in Sugar they will be deleted from your CMS.

    Plus! if you need a document management solution they have integrated KnowledgeTree with Joomla and Sugar so you have great extensibility!
